Silver Seal Enmore Demerara Rum 1977
"Explosion of plum compote," one member wrote, and that captures this old Enmore well. Burned wood, caramelized walnuts, dark chocolate, tobacco and dried plums, all thick and oily with an almost honey-like texture. Most call it heavy, creamy and endlessly long. The 64.4% is impressively integrated for the strength, though a few still find the heat a touch sharp over that dark sweetness.

Review by Jakob
Intense spectrum of predominantly cocoa, oak, caramel, tobacco and spices. This is accompanied by subtle mineral notes, hints of dried and yellow fruit and roasted nuts. The aroma spectrum of the heavy sweetness is almost perfectly pronounced, especially on the nose, from caramel to vanilla and fully ripe mango. In the mouth, the high alcohol content is unfortunately a little too noticeable and somewhat overshadows the overall profile. In the end, I feel there is a slight lack of contrast to this heavy sweetness, such as dark fruits or more nuanced spices. Nevertheless, this is still a great distillate.

Review by LukaŽiga
9,2:On the nose,the first impression we get is a very round rum with roasted wood notes like caramel, Demerara sugar, nuts and chocolate, a bit spicy with vanilla and cinnamon, velvety, buttery with an orange, dried fruits like apricots, prunes and a little varnish. On aeration, bourbon ageing is even more evident with toasted coconut, brioche, cocoa, leather, as a molasses brings us some tea. 9,2:On the palate, the attack is immediately bourbon like, very tasty and round with dried fruits like apricots, prunes, raisins, then orange, a bit later with mango and toasted coconut.Here we have charred wood notes, very creamy with caramel, cream toffee, nuts and dark chocolate, an apple is baked, a bit smoky, spices with vanilla and cinnamon.The molasses is earthy with tobacco, musty. After resting, some menthol arises, the rum becomes a bit bitter, the fruits candied and for a moment some salt is present. 9,1:The finish is long, with dry, spicy and roasted wood notes, a bit bitter, earthy, as the fruits are dried and candied..

Review by Serge
Old, dark Guyana profile with wood, leather, cocoa and lots of tobacco. But anything but dusty. Immediately after pouring, the nose is unexpectedly fruity with prunes - but there are also fresher notes of cherry, orange, even some mango and pineapple. There is also vanilla, varnish, dark chocolate and cinnamon. Also some smoke. The pleasantly high ABV brings the aromas to the nose with plenty of steam. Darker and roastier on the palate with a slight coffee bitterness, a fine sweetness of burnt sugar, soaked prunes, ... a poem.

Review by Mopar Rules
oh my god! Explosion 💥 of plum compot on the first nose, then burned wood and caramelized walnuts. ABV is almost not realizable. Cherry flavors rise after the rum is resting a while in the glass. Palate: Oh, I love these massive falavors. Your grandma’s plum jam forgotten in the oven. Burned, a bitterness from the long time it has been in the cask, oily, it really fills the mouth with all these flavors. And these flavors stay there for an endless finish. Not as complex as the top caronis or these old Long Ponds, but massive. Every flavor, the burned caramel, the plums and cherries,the wood is quite dominant and just massively intense. What a rum! Review by crazyforgoodbooze
A really fantastic old Demerara! Strong bitter-sweet mocha, dark dark chocolate, Virginia tobacco, caramelized Demerara sugar, cinnamon, prune, apple and orange and all very concentrated, heavy and oily and yet extremely harmonious. The alcohol integration is very good and the cask influence is surprisingly low for 32y in cask! Unusually sweet and delicious, which I definitely wouldn't have expected! The only thing missing for me would be an aromatic contrast to achieve a little more complexity. But that's complaining on a damn high level!

Review by Pavel Spacek
.. Enmore - drive distiller, now just a functional distillation device. Probably the only wooden still in the world that is very popular. The Enmore rums have a flavour of ash, leather, heavy wood, which will delight especially the lovers of whiskey. And if in the traditional Guyanese way the producer adds a little molasses to the rum, you have a unique very distinctive and heavy rum in the bottle. One of my favourites.
